Created around May 22.  36″ x 24″.  I was eager to try something new using hard lines and had this brown canvas lying around, one of the last of several I recently bought.  “FLORES GRATIA FLORIBUS” is Latin for “Flowers for the sake of Flowers”.  I got the idea from the Metro Goldwyn Mayer motto “Ars gratia Artis”, which is Latin for “art for art’s sake” and was a catchphrase/slogan for the Impressionists.
